Overview: Estimating activity duration accurately is important to the success of any project. You and your team estimate the various requirements of cost, time, and resources throughout your project. Although activity duration estimation looks at the time it takes to complete the entire project, activity duration estimation is dependent on other time and resource estimates. Estimates are never exact. That's their nature - they are best guesses. But you can improve your accuracy by dividing the estimation task into three distinct steps: determining a Work Breakdown Structure (WBS), estimating the amount of work and duration of work packages, and calculating the project schedule.
